Hi all, Not really posted much to the list in the last while as I didn't really get time to read it, but I intend to be different this year and try and contribute more than I have in the past. To give you a bit of background, myself and my friend Mick have been broadcasting an "electronica" show from Dublin, Ireland's Xfm for the last 8 years and 51 weeks! This week (9.1.5) it's our 9th birthday so we're celebrating with our usual round-up of the previous year. So that's why our last show before the Christmas break ( http://www.xfmdublin.com/chill.ram ) contained nothing from 2004. Anyway, enough blather, here's a few previous playlists if you're not familiar with our show. Talk soon, Paul Chillage.
